Being an EYPer in the 1990s
A lot of us know that an International Session without email or digital cameras was done differently. But do you know who initially did Teambuilding in EYP, or what exactly organising, editing, or presiding an International Session in the 1990s looked like? This panel will discuss these questions, and what it was like to be an EYPer as a non-EU citizen or as a member of a very young National Committee! We have invited some great speakers to talk to us about all of this, and more.

Panel discussion: Looking ahead to post-COVID-19 Europe
Last year’s Reunion took place amid rising COVID-19 cases and increasingly strict lockdowns—this time around we are slowly seeing measures lift. What does this mean for different professionals, like those working in culture, sustainability, or health? More importantly, how have professional fields changed because of the pandemic? Our panel of speakers from varying backgrounds and jobs will tackle this question, and we’ll open the floor up to yours as well!
